The usual trap: thinking very bright low-frequency light can eject electrons. How to avoid it: frequency decides IF electrons come out; intensity only decides HOW MANY. Go back to the definition — light ejects electrons from a metal only if its frequency exceeds a threshold, regardless of intensity.
